*Dinebra retroflexa (Vahl) Panzer. Common name: Viper Grass. Habitat: Disturbed areas, probably just a waif. Distribution: Native of Africa and s. Asia. This species has been collected as a waif in Mecklenburg County, NC (Mellichamp, Matthews, & Smithka 1987).
Origin/Endemic status: Paleotropics
Synonymy ⓘ: = FNA25, K4, NS, POWO, Peterson et al (2012); = n/a — C, RAB, Tat. Basionym: Cynosurus retroflexus Vahl 1791
